Sewing Kits 4 Kids was created by two sisters. They grew-up in the country and were taught how to sew, garden, cook, and care for animals. They noticed that not many of the children around them were learning these life skills. They decided to create a business that would teach children basic sewing skills with fun and educational kits. Each kit contains step-by-step instructions and materials to complete a project. Depending on your kit, you will need to have your own sewing needle and may need thread, scissors, glue and/or an iron. For our review, we received a Ladybug Pillow kit and a Button Bag kit.
We had A LOT of fun with these kits. Savannah (6 years old) was really excited to make the Button Bag to carry all of her school pencils in. Cheyenne (almost 4 years old) want to make the Ladybug Pillow for her doll. We found the step-by-step directions easy to follow. They clearly taught the girls (and me!) how to complete the stitches and guided us through the project. Savannah was able to complete almost the entire Button Bag on her own. Cheyenne needed a little bit more help but was still able to do a good amount of the sewing on her Ladybug Pillow.
